    Job Summary
    We are seeking an experienced Network Security Analyst II to support enterprise cybersecurity and network security operations. The ideal candidate will have strong hands-on experience in security operations, SIEM, SOAR, EDR, NDR, threat detection, incident response, and security monitoring across on-premises, cloud, and endpoint environments.
    This position requires strong analytical and investigative skills, sound technical judgment,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ently in a fast-paced security operations environment.
    Note: Candidates selected for this position may be subject to a pre-employment security/background review to determine employment eligibility.
    Key Responsibilities
    • Monitor security alerts, logs, network events, endpoint telemetry, and threat intelligence feeds.
    • Analyze suspicious activity, anomalous network behavior, malware indicators, endpoint detections, and SIEM correlation events.
    • Perform incident triage, investigation, escalation, containment coordination, and documentation.
    • Develop, tune, and maintain detection rules, dashboards, alerts, playbooks, and security queries.
    • Improve security visibility across network, endpoint, identity, and cloud environments.
    • Conduct threat hunting using KQL, SPL, packet/session analysis, endpoint telemetry, and other investigative techniques.
    • Support vulnerability, risk, and security control assessments.
    • Investigate security incidents and document findings, impact, remediation, and recommended corrective actions.
    • Collaborate with network, infrastructure, cloud, endpoint, and application teams to investigate and mitigate security risks.
    • Monitor emerging cyber threats, attack techniques, indicators of compromise, and security best practices.
    • Support compliance, audit, metrics, and security reporting activities.
    • Participate in incident response, escalation, and after-action review activities as required.
    • Maintain accurate investigation notes, operational documentation, metrics, and leadership-ready reports.
    • Provide occasional support outside standard business hours for high-priority security incidents or planned maintenance.
